Choosing a stroller wagon for two kids involves more than just looking at features; it requires understanding how different factors align with your lifestyle and needs. Consider terrain adaptability if you plan outdoor adventures, as some wagons excel on rough surfaces while others are best for smooth pavements. Size and foldability matter if storage space or car transport is limited. Safety features like harnesses and high seats ensure peace of mind, especially for younger children. Budget and long-term value should guide your decision, balancing initial cost against durability and added features that will last through growing needs.Terrain and Suspension
If you frequently use your stroller wagon on uneven surfaces like parks, dirt trails, or beaches, look for models with good suspension and rugged tires. Some wagons are designed specifically for all-terrain use, providing smoother rides and better stability. Models with larger wheels and shock absorption tend to perform well outdoors but may add weight and bulk. Conversely, if most outings are on paved sidewalks or shopping malls, lighter, smaller-wheeled wagons will be easier to maneuver and store, but might struggle on rough terrain.
Size, Weight, and Foldability
Size and weight influence how easily you can transport and store the wagon. Heavier models often feel more stable but can be cumbersome to lift or fold. Foldable designs are essential for fitting into small trunks or closets, yet some fold mechanisms are complex or bulky when collapsed. Consider how often you’ll need to fold the wagon—if it’s daily, prioritize models with one-handed folding and compact storage. If space isn’t an issue, weight might be less critical, allowing for more durable or feature-rich options.
Safety and Comfort Features
Look for high-quality harnesses, high seats, and secure canopy systems. These features protect your children from bumps, sun exposure, and sudden stops. Adjustable harnesses and padded seats improve comfort, especially for longer outings. High seats also enhance visibility and reduce the risk of children leaning out or slipping. Be cautious of models with flimsy harnesses or low sides; safety should never be compromised for style or convenience.
Price and Long-Term Value
Stroller wagons span a wide price range, often reflecting build quality, features, and brand reputation. Cheaper models may lack suspension, sturdy frames, or extra storage, leading to higher replacement costs over time. Investing in a slightly pricier model with durable materials and versatile features can save money and frustration in the long run. Consider whether the extra features, like removable canopies or adjustable handles, justify the higher cost for your specific needs.
Additional Features and Accessories
Extras like parent organizers, cup holders, removable canopies, and storage pockets add convenience. These features make daily outings more manageable but often come at a cost in weight or complexity. Some wagons include accessories that can be purchased separately, allowing customization as your needs evolve. Be mindful of how these extras impact maneuverability and storage—more features aren’t always better if they hinder ease of use.
Frequently Asked Questions
Can I use a stroller wagon for both indoor and outdoor trips?
Yes, many stroller wagons are designed for both indoor and outdoor use, but their effectiveness depends on the model. Wagons with all-terrain tires and suspension systems perform better outdoors on uneven surfaces, while lighter, smaller models are more suitable for indoor spaces or smooth pavements. Consider your primary usage environment to select a wagon that balances maneuverability indoors with durability outdoors.
How much weight can a typical stroller wagon for two kids handle?
Most stroller wagons for two kids support between 100 to 180 pounds, depending on the model. Higher weight capacities are vital if you plan to carry additional cargo or if your children are older and larger. Always check the manufacturer’s weight limits to ensure safety and longevity of the wagon, avoiding overloading which can compromise stability or damage the frame.
Are foldable stroller wagons durable enough for regular outdoor use?
Many foldable models are built with durable materials like steel frames and weather-resistant fabrics, but their longevity depends on construction quality. Wagons with reinforced joints, high-quality suspension, and sturdy wheels tend to withstand regular outdoor use better. Avoid overly lightweight or flimsy folding wagons if you plan frequent outdoor adventures, as these may wear out faster or become unsafe over time.
What safety features should I prioritize in a stroller wagon?
Prioritize models with secure 5-point harnesses, high sides, and adjustable canopies to protect your children from sun and debris. Look for stable frames with wide wheelbases to prevent tipping, especially on uneven terrain. Reflective accents and bright colors can enhance visibility, while a reliable braking system prevents accidental movement when parked. Safety features should be non-negotiable, especially if your children are very young or new to riding.
Is it worth paying more for an all-terrain stroller wagon?
If you plan to use the wagon predominantly outdoors, especially on rough or uneven surfaces, investing in an all-terrain model can be worthwhile. These wagons typically feature larger wheels, better suspension, and more rugged frames, providing a smoother ride and increased durability. However, if your primary use is on paved surfaces or indoors, a less expensive, lightweight wagon might meet your needs at a lower cost.
